Configure Shipping Options for Your Shopify Store
Ready to get your products delivering to customers worldwide? Shopify makes setting up shipping a breeze! This step-by-step tutorial will guide you through the process, helping you configure a shipping strategy that meets your business needs. First, head over to your Shopify admin panel and navigate to Configurations. Then, click on "Shipping" from the menu.
- This is where you can set up shipping zones based on geographical location. Define which countries or states your products ship to and the associated costs.
- Continue with setting up shipping rates. Choose from a variety of options like flat rate, calculated based on weight, or even free shipping for certain orders.
- Don't forget to verify your settings by placing a test order and monitoring the process.

Mastering Shopify's Tax Settings and Calculations
When you're running an online store powered by Shopify, accurately calculating and managing sales tax is critical. Shopify provides a comprehensive set of tools to help you set up your tax settings, ensuring correctness with varying VAT regulations across jurisdictions. To properly manage taxes on your Shopify store, begin by identifying your business's location and the specific tax requirements that govern your products or services.
Shopify allows you to create tax rates for different locations and merchandise. You can also adjust automatic tax calculation based on the customer's shipping address, automating the process. It's important to regularly review and amend your tax settings as regulations shift.
- Employing Shopify's built-in reports can provide valuable insights into your sales tax activity.
- Grasping the different types of taxes, such as sales tax, use tax, and value added tax (VAT), is crucial.

Optimize Your Shipping Costs with Shopify Solutions
Running an ecommerce business means continuously seeking ways to maximize your profits. One area where you can make a big impact is by finding the best possible shipping rates. Shopify's comprehensive logistics solutions are designed to do just that, helping you reduce costs while offering a seamless journey for your customers.
With Shopify Shipping, you can enjoy access to discounted rates from leading carriers like USPS, UPS, and FedEx. You can also easily print shipping labels directly from your dashboard, eliminating the need for external software.
,Moreover, Shopify's integrated rate calculator helps you contrast shipping options and choose the most cost-effective solution for each order. This allows you to adjust your pricing strategies and increase your overall profitability.
